Vocabulary

Definition of "affairs of the heart"

Hi,

Can I refer feelings in general as "affairs of the heart"?
Ex:
1. Feelings are hard to manage because sometimes they are a little bit illogical.
2. Affairs of the heart are hard to manage because sometimes they are a little bit illogical.

Thanks, A.L.
  

Top answer

Feelings cover a very wide range of emotions. You could be sad because your puppy got hurt or you could be angry because someone stole a dollar out of your pocket. How about feeling happy because you got a good grade on a report.

  • Feelings cover a very wide range of emotions.
  • You could be sad because your puppy got hurt or you could be angry because someone stole a dollar out of your pocket.
  • How about feeling happy because you got a good grade on a report.
  • Affairs of the heart is a term that is used to refer to things that are more involved with love.
  • I have never used it except to refer to love between a man and a woman.
